Compliance context

AB 802 (Public Resources Code §25402.10)

A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.

What is 17075 Devonshire St's energy grade?

17075 Devonshire St scores 100 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band A (High performer (85–100)) — in its 2021 California dis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does 17075 Devonshire St use?

Its 2021 site energy-use intensity was 8.7 kBtu/ft² across 79,450 sq ft, including 198,457 kWh of electricity and 152 therms of natural gas.
